Bringing It Home

by Kevin   Aug 19, 2004


Shuffle....shuffle....
every one of you a dealer
God forbid they have a moment
sweet respite from constant roaming

Shuffling....shuffling....
process the seekers necessities
reality check their fevered dreams
brick it all to a wall of service

Shuffled....shuffled....
discontent is such good business
send the careening into careers
pay them peanuts and feed their fears
